Label Text
Drawn on costly vellum, this large, elaborate landscape was probably made for a collector. The majestic tree in the foreground has been rendered with exceptionally varied penwork, its twisted trunk and feathery foliage built up with layers of fine detail. Little is known of de Cock and only a handful of works can be securely attributed to him. His treatment of the woodland at left suggests a familiarity with the work of Gillis van Coninxloo, an important forest painter of the previous generation.
Provenance
E. Parsons & Sons (London), cat. 38, 1921, lot 158; purchased there by Sir Robert Witt, London (1872-1952) (£4.9); Witt Bequest 1952
